Contributing to these plans, we are seeking to expand the citys Educational Psychology Service in order to meet the high demand for our services. There are over 450 schools across the local authority, over 95% of whom we work with and support. Birmingham truly is a great place to live and work.

We are passionate about applying psychology to support the learning, development and emotional wellbeing of children and young people. Our service vision for working with children and young people is ambitious; we believe that every young person should have the opportunity to thrive, to be fully included and to help them reach their potential.

Our service provides professional psychological services for children, young people, and families in a wide range of educational settings across the city. Joining one of our inclusive and friendly teams means working alongside over 50 HCPC registered educational psychologists, many of whom have a range of specialisms and interests.

We are proud of our large Assistant Psychologist team based in our four locality teams, who support team delivery.

We also have close ties with University Educational Psychology training courses and provide a large number of placements for trainee colleagues whether it be time limited Fieldwork A or B placements, or Year 2 and 3 Trainees based in one of our four locality teams.

We also have a pool of Associate EP colleagues who support our statutory commitments and who are highly valued within our service.

The service has strong and positive relationships with the local authority, with schools and partner agencies. We are well integrated into the broader systems of support for vulnerable children and young people and their families in the city.

The Educational Psychology Service has an excellent reputation and has a strong commitment to innovation, quality improvement, research and development. We are engaged in a variety of initiatives such as SCERTS, ELSA, VIG, VERP, MeLSA,Trauma Informed Attachment Aware Schools and Restorative Practice.

Our EPs have the freedom to engage in a range of work at the individual, small/ whole group, staff, parent, or systemic level. We are not a prescriptive service and value the diversity of approach each of our psychologists.

We are committed to promoting professional development at all levels, with opportunities to take on leadership roles within the service for those aspiring to become managers. We are also a friendly and highly supportive service where collaboration and peer supervision are actively encouraged.
